Who We Are
The Forum for Global Studies (FGS) is a Delhi-based independent, nonpartisan think tank founded in September 2021. In today’s interconnected world, geopolitical shifts profoundly impact our lives, making it imperative to develop a deeper understanding of international relations. FGS is an emerging multidisciplinary think tank that serves as a platform for dialogue on India’s foreign policy, energy security, tech governance, digital transformation, international trade and law, and evolving geopolitics. We regularly host programs that offer a unique opportunity to engage with eminent thinkers and policymakers. Through in-depth research and diverse initiatives, FGS promotes international collaboration, fosters engagement with policymakers, tech leaders, academicians, and stimulates public debate on pressing global challenges.
